Atlanta Braves analyst Paul Byrd joined Dukes & Bell to talk about the first two games of the NLCS as the underdog Braves have taken a surprising 2-0 lead as the series is headed west.

Paul told the guys it’s time the Los Angeles media gives the Braves some credit.

Byrd talked about the media narrative that the Braves are only winning due to the Dodgers failures.

“Credit the Braves for getting hits, I don’t care when you use some of the Dodgers pitchers they’re all really, really good and they had the lead late in the game,” Byrd said. “The Braves hitters came through and they took chances on the base pads, Ron Washington was a maniac at third base swinging the arms. Something that upsets me a little bit about LA, and if you’re a writer listening to me or whatever I want you to hear this, give the Atlanta Braves credit. Your team is not losing, the Atlanta Braves are winning, they’re out playing you right now.”

“Baseball is a game where you already said it’s not the best players that win, it’s the best team and anything can happen in baseball when these guys get excited, the great chemistry they play above the level maybe. You have a guy hitting .220 who’s tearing it up, Rosario in this series is so excited to be here, he’s hitting .556! How do you manage against a guy who’s hitting .556, who’s hot with crazy energy and a crowd that’s going nuts? That’s not easy, so if you’re listening to me LA, give my guys some credit.”
